The name of the settlement was first recorded two hundred years ago.

Wismar received its civic rights and came into the possession of Mecklenburg. Later it had entered a pact with Lübeck and Rostock, in order to defend itself against the numerous Baltic sea pirates. This developed into the Hanseatic League. During the last two centuries it has been a flourishing Hanseatic town, with important woollen factories.
